
Overview
After logging in, the Overview page provides a summary of your current collateral health, platform coverage, and verification status. It is the default landing page and is intended to offer a high-level view of system integrity.
Status Overview

Collaterals Monitored
Displays the total number of DCAP collateral files currently tracked, including certificates, TCB info, revocation lists, and identity files.
FMSPCs Managed
Indicates how many distinct FMSPCs are being actively monitored. Each FMSPC corresponds to a unique SGX or TDX platform configuration.
Networks Covered
Shows the number of blockchains where FMSPCs are actively tracked and corresponding collateral is kept up to date.
Recent Activity

This panel logs recent updates made by the system, such as:
Collateral fetch operations
Sync events with Intel’s servers
Changes in verification status
Use this to verify that the system is running as expected and performing periodic updates.
Collateral Status

This provides a summary of the current state of all collateral files managed through the dashboard.
Valid: Files currently up to date and valid
Expiring: Files that will reach expiration soon
Expired: Files that are no longer valid and may cause verification to fail
Missing: Files expected based on configured FMSPCs but not retrieved
If collateral files are marked as Expiring, no action is required. Collateral is automatically refreshed before expiration to ensure continuous verification.
